Question: Cryptographic hash functions are used in almost all Internet traffic and so their security is essential for Internet security. When MD5 was broken in 2004
Cryptographic hash functions are used in almost all Internet traffic and so their security is essential for Internet security. When MD5 was broken in 2004 (see e.g. Wang & Yu, 2005), there was panic across the world since all Internet traffic based on MD5 could no long be trusted (e.g., the certificate could be forged, a virus could be inserted into the software distribution process).
1) Evaluate the cryptographic hash function security.
2) Discuss what you believe is more important for Internet security and why: encryption schemes such as AES or cryptographic hash functions such as SHA1/SHA2/SHA3.
3) Think about your daily use of computers and where the hash function is involved. If the hash function is broken, what would be the impact on your daily activities?
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
